Creating accessible and user-friendly municipal websites is a critical task for local governments. Such websites serve as the digital front door to the services and information that citizens need. From paying utility bills online to finding information about local parks and events, a well-designed municipal website can significantly enhance the citizen experience while improving operational efficiency for the government.

Understanding Municipal Website Design

Municipal website design focuses on creating digital platforms that are not only visually appealing but also highly functional and accessible to people with various abilities. This includes adhering to web accessibility standards like the Web Content Accessibility Guidelines (WCAG) to ensure that everyone, including those with disabilities, can access information and services. Best Practices for Creating Accessible Websites

To develop a user-friendly and accessible municipal website, local governments must follow several best practices. These include ensuring that the website is easy to navigate, content is clearly written and easy to understand, and that the site is compatible with assistive technologies. Additionally, websites should be designed to be responsive, meaning they are easily viewable and functional on a wide range of devices, from desktop computers to smartphones.

Guidelines for User-Friendly Design

Creating a user-friendly municipal website involves more than just technical accessibility; it requires a deep understanding of the end-users’ needs and behaviors. This can include incorporating interactive elements like calendars for local events, online forms for service requests, and an efficient search function to quickly direct users to the information they need.
